Automatic watches are purely mechanical and are not electronic. As such, they are powered by a tiny main spring that drives the watch mechanism and do not require any battery whatsoever. September 21, The first digit signifies the year the watch was made. This will present a problem because you may not be able to distinguish whether the watch was made in or The digits always range from 0 to 9.

The second digit denotes the production month. Seiko uses for January to September. October is represented by the number 0 zero, not the letter "O" while November and December are abbreviated to "N" and "D" respectively. The remaining 4 digits represent the production number of the watch in a sequence. It is generally believed that the first watch produced every month begins with "" and the last watch made in that month ends with "".

Going by this convention, up to 10, watches of a particular model could be manufactured in one month. The sequence number is reset for the following month. Therefore if Seiko made up to 4, pieces in February, the last watch produced will have the the sequence number For the following month of March, the first watch produced will have the sequence number instead of Technorati Tags: Seiko , production date , article , production year , serial number.
